

About Ilona
Ilona Bobrytska (b. 1997, Ukraine) is a contemporary visual artist living and working in California, USA. Holding a Master’s degree in Monumental Art, she creates expressive abstract-figurative paintings that explore femininity, transformation, emotion, and the subtle dialogue between memory and time. Her visual language is built on bold color, movement, and light, resulting in atmospheric and emotionally charged compositions.
Drawing on her European art education and her experience in the United States, Ilona has developed an intuitive and sensitive approach to painting. Alongside her large-scale works, she creates small-format pieces—intimate fragments where ideas and states take on a more concentrated form. Her paintings have been exhibited in Ukraine, Europe, China, and the United States, and are held in private collections worldwide, inviting viewers into a space of reflection and personal resonance.
